Abstract

Wireless network is a collection of number of nodes. There is a single source and a single destination or number of destinations connected by the number of ways. Nodes communicate to each other by sending signals that transmits message through single source to single destination. Signals send by source are in the encoded form. When receiver receives it, process of decoding/encoding with information received from previous nodes is done. In the wireless network there is a problem of finding path which is optimal and requires less energy. In proposed system we find the optimal routing path in signal transmission from source to destination in multi-hop network. We use the rate-less code which is used to collect the data in the transmission process. This will be decrease the total energy and reduce delays in transmission. Proposed system increases significant performance of system by finding the shortest path using Floyd-Warshall algorithm. Floyd Warshall's algorithm is finds shortest path between all nodes and we have to run only once. And which is faster than those algorithms because it runs only once to find shortest path. So we are using Floyd Warshall's algorithm in multi graph system to improve performance and chances of average path loss is very low we have compared existing and proposed system based on path loss.
